Technical Specifications

The Stihl BR 600 is a powerful and efficient backpack leaf blower designed for professional and demanding applications. Here are the key technical specifications⁚

  • Engine⁚ 2-stroke, air-cooled, gasoline engine
  • Displacement⁚ 59.8 cc
  • Power Output⁚ 2.6 kW (3.5 hp)
  • Air Speed⁚ 320.4 km/h (199 mph)
  • Maximum Air Speed⁚ 381.6 km/h (237 mph)
  • Air Flow⁚ 1150 m³/h (407 cfm)
  • Fuel Tank Capacity⁚ 0.75 liters (0.2 gallons)
  • Weight (without fuel)⁚ 10.3 kg (22.7 lbs)
  • Noise Level⁚ 107 dB(A)
  • Vibration Level⁚ 5.5 m/s²

Types of Cutting Boards

Cutting boards come in a variety of styles and constructions, each with its own unique characteristics and advantages․ Understanding the different types will help you choose the best option for your needs and preferences․ Two of the most common types of cutting boards are end-grain and edge-grain boards․

End-grain cutting boards, as the name suggests, are constructed with the wood grain running perpendicular to the cutting surface․ This type of construction provides a denser and more durable surface, offering superior knife protection and a more forgiving cutting experience․ The end-grain structure helps to absorb the impact of knife blades, reducing the risk of dulling and extending the lifespan of your knives․

Edge-grain cutting boards, on the other hand, are constructed with the wood grain running parallel to the cutting surface․ While not as durable as end-grain boards, edge-grain boards offer a smoother cutting surface and are often more affordable to produce․ Edge-grain boards are also known for their visually appealing grain patterns, adding a touch of elegance to your kitchen․

The choice between end-grain and edge-grain cutting boards ultimately comes down to personal preference and intended use․ For those who prioritize knife protection and durability, end-grain boards are the preferred choice․ If you value affordability and a smoother cutting surface, edge-grain boards might be a better fit for your needs․

Choosing the Right Wood

Selecting the appropriate wood for your cutting board is crucial for both its functionality and longevity․ Hardwoods are generally preferred for cutting boards due to their durability and resistance to wear and tear․ When choosing a wood, consider its hardness, grain pattern, and resistance to moisture․ Here are some popular choices for cutting board construction⁚

  • Maple⁚ A popular choice for cutting boards, maple offers a balance of hardness, durability, and a pleasing grain pattern․ It is also relatively resistant to moisture and staining․
  • Cherry⁚ Cherry wood is known for its beautiful reddish-brown color and tight grain, making it a visually appealing choice․ While slightly softer than maple, it is still a good option for cutting boards, especially for those who prioritize aesthetics․
  • Walnut⁚ Walnut is a strong and durable hardwood with a distinctive dark brown color and distinctive grain patterns․ It offers excellent resistance to moisture and is a good choice for those who prefer a rich and elegant look․
  • Hardwoods⁚ Other hardwoods like oak, beech, and ash are also suitable for cutting boards, each possessing unique characteristics in terms of hardness, grain, and color․ Researching the specific properties of each hardwood will help you choose the best option for your project․

It is important to note that some woods, such as softwoods like pine or cedar, are not recommended for cutting boards․ These woods are more prone to scratches, dents, and moisture absorption, making them less suitable for frequent use․

Finishing

The finishing process for your cutting board is essential for both aesthetics and functionality․ It protects the wood from moisture, stains, and wear and tear while enhancing its visual appeal․ Here’s a breakdown of the finishing steps⁚

  1. Sanding⁚ Start by sanding the entire surface of the cutting board with progressively finer grit sandpaper․ Begin with a coarse grit (80-120) to smooth out any rough areas and then move to finer grits (150-220) for a smoother finish․ Sand with the grain of the wood to avoid scratches․
  2. Applying a Food-Safe Finish⁚ Choose a food-safe finish specifically designed for cutting boards․ Options include mineral oil, beeswax, butcher block oil, or a combination of these․ Apply the finish according to the manufacturer’s instructions, typically by rubbing it into the wood with a cloth or brush․
  3. Multiple Coats⁚ Apply multiple coats of the finish to create a protective layer․ Allow each coat to dry completely before applying the next․ The number of coats required depends on the type of finish and the desired level of protection․ Ensure the finish is evenly distributed and adheres well to the wood․
  4. Buffing and Polishing⁚ After the final coat dries, you can buff and polish the surface to enhance its sheen and durability․ Use a clean cloth or a buffing tool to create a smooth and polished finish․ Buffing also helps to even out any minor imperfections․
  5. Maintaining the Finish⁚ Once the finish is complete, maintain its integrity by regularly re-applying the chosen finish․ The frequency of re-application depends on the type of finish and the usage of the cutting board․ Regular maintenance ensures the board remains protected and attractive․

A well-finished cutting board not only enhances its appearance but also extends its lifespan․ Choose a food-safe finish, apply it properly, and maintain it consistently to enjoy a beautiful and functional cutting board for years to come․

Tax Implications

In South Dakota, motor vehicles are subject to a 4% motor vehicle tax on the purchase price, but they are not subject to state and local sales taxes. While most cities and towns in South Dakota have a local sales tax, this typically does not apply to vehicle purchases. Therefore, the primary tax burden on vehicle transactions in South Dakota is the 4% motor vehicle tax.

When purchasing a vehicle in South Dakota, it is important to understand that the buyer is responsible for paying the 4% motor vehicle tax. The seller is typically not required to collect this tax, but they should be aware of the tax implications and provide the buyer with the necessary documentation for registration.

Engine Options and Performance

The 2021 Jeep Grand Cherokee offers a range of engine options to suit different driving needs and preferences. The standard powertrain is a 3.6-liter Pentastar V6 engine, delivering 295 horsepower and 260 lb-ft of torque, providing a balance of power and efficiency. For those seeking more power, a 5.7-liter Hemi V8 engine is available, generating 360 horsepower and 390 lb-ft of torque. This option delivers a more robust performance, ideal for towing or off-road adventures. For the ultimate performance, the Jeep Grand Cherokee SRT and Trackhawk models feature a supercharged 6.2-liter Hemi V8 engine, producing 475 horsepower and 707 horsepower respectively. These models are designed for high-performance driving with impressive acceleration and handling capabilities. All engine options are paired with an 8-speed automatic transmission, providing smooth and responsive gear changes. Shower Opening Dimensions

Before you begin installing your Delta shower door‚ it’s essential to ensure your shower opening meets the required dimensions. This step is crucial for a proper fit and smooth operation of the door. The Delta shower door installation instructions provide specific guidelines for different shower configurations. Here’s a breakdown of the typical dimensions⁚

  • 60 Tub/Shower: The minimum opening width for this configuration is 50-1/8 inches‚ while the maximum is 59-3/8 inches. This provides ample space for the shower door to move freely without obstruction.
  • 48 Shower⁚ For a 48-inch shower‚ the minimum opening width is 43-3/8 inches‚ and the maximum is 47-3/8 inches. This ensures a secure and well-fitted installation for your Delta shower door.

Beyond width‚ it’s also important to consider the plumbness of your shower walls. Walls must be within 3/8 inch (10 mm) of plumb for a proper installation. This means that the walls should be vertical and parallel to each other. If your walls are not plumb‚ it may be necessary to adjust them before installing your Delta shower door.

Balancing Chemical Equations

Balancing chemical equations is a fundamental step in stoichiometry․ It ensures that the number of atoms of each element on the reactant side of the equation equals the number of atoms of that element on the product side․ This principle adheres to the law of conservation of mass, stating that matter cannot be created or destroyed in a chemical reaction․

Balancing chemical equations involves adjusting the stoichiometric coefficients in front of each chemical formula․ These coefficients represent the number of moles of each reactant and product involved in the reaction․ Balancing equations is essential for accurate calculations in stoichiometry, as it provides the mole ratios needed to determine the quantities of reactants and products involved․

Limiting Reactants

In many chemical reactions, reactants are not present in stoichiometrically equivalent amounts․ This means that one reactant will be completely consumed before the other, limiting the amount of product that can be formed․ This reactant is called the limiting reactant, while the reactant that is not completely consumed is called the excess reactant․

Identifying the limiting reactant is crucial for predicting the maximum amount of product that can be formed in a reaction; This concept is particularly important in industrial settings where maximizing product yield and minimizing waste are essential․

Percent Yield

The percent yield is a measure of the efficiency of a chemical reaction․ It represents the ratio of the actual yield (the amount of product obtained in an experiment) to the theoretical yield (the maximum amount of product that can be formed based on stoichiometric calculations), expressed as a percentage․

In real-world chemical reactions, the actual yield often falls short of the theoretical yield due to various factors, such as incomplete reactions, side reactions, and losses during product isolation․ The percent yield provides a valuable insight into the efficiency of a reaction and can help identify potential areas for improvement․
